Giant Ichneumon Wasp

Megarhyssa sp.

Description:

I'm thinking it's a male Megarhyssa macrurus, but I'd love confirmation from someone who knows what they're talking about. :]

Habitat:

Dry wooded area, trees 20-30 years old. Area recently cleared of bush honeysuckle (he's perching upon a cane, there)

Notes:

A week or so later I saw what I presume was the female flying about with that scary, scary, harmless ovipositor!
